Subject: [PATCH v2] regulator: dbx500: Remove unused debugfs goto label

The following build warning is seen after commit 8bdaa43808b7 ("regulator:
dbx500: no need to check return value of debugfs_create functions"):
drivers/regulator/dbx500-prcmu.c:144:1: warning: label 'exit_no_debugfs' defined but not used [-Wunused-label]
Remove the unused label and its associated error message.

diff --git a/drivers/regulator/dbx500-prcmu.c b/drivers/regulator/dbx500-prcmu.c
index 7395ad2105ab..8b70bfe88019 100644
--- a/drivers/regulator/dbx500-prcmu.c
+++ b/drivers/regulator/dbx500-prcmu.c
@@ -141,8 +141,6 @@ ux500_regulator_debug_init(struct platform_device *pdev,
kfree(rdebug.state_before_suspend);
exit_destroy_power_state:
debugfs_remove_recursive(rdebug.dir);
-exit_no_debugfs:
- dev_err(&pdev->dev, "failed to create debugfs entries.\n");
return -ENOMEM;
}
